![]() |
Show 150 posts per page |
.dsy:it. (http://www.dsy.it/forum/)
- Architettura degli elaboratori e delle reti (http://www.dsy.it/forum/forumdisplay.php?forumid=210)
-- [Pedersini] Cche con memoria principale (http://www.dsy.it/forum/showthread.php?threadid=39805)
[Pedersini] Cache con memoria principale
Salve a tutti, avrei un problema in questo esercizio:
Un processore caratterizzato da uno spazio di indirizzamento della memoria principale di 1 GByte e da un bus dati di 16 bit viene dotato di una memoria cache associativa a 2 vie, di capacità totale C = 1 MByte e con linee di 8 parole. Dimensionare la cache, evidenziando le dimensioni di tutti i campi, e disegnarne lo schema circuitale dettagliato. Determinare i valori di: byte offset, word offset, index e tag relativi all’indirizzo: A = 2^20 + 2^15 + 2^10 + 2^5 + 5.
non mi ricordo come trovare il bus indirizzi partendo dalla memoria principale.
Se qualcuno potesse aiutarmi ne sarei grato.
Grazie!!
a) MP 1GB(2^30Byte) dove ogni parola è composta da 16bit(2^1Byte)
b) Dividendo 2^30/2^1 trovi il numero di parole contenute nella MP 2^29Words
c) ceil(log2(2^29))=29bit per gli indirizzi.
__________________
.. ±·ø·±-`` MuSiC iS My LanGuAGe ´´-±·ø·± ..
E il resto dell'esercizio come si fa? Una volta trovata la lunghezza dell'indirizzo come si dimensiona la cache?
| All times are GMT. The time now is 10:55. | Show all 3 posts from this thread on one page |
Powered by: vBulletin Version 2.3.1
Copyright © Jelsoft Enterprises Limited 2000 - 2002.